Early miata oil filter stud (non oil cooler stud)
 
Is there anywhere we can get the earlier studs that were on the non-oil cooled miatas? I am looking to get rid of the stock oil cooler and run the shorter stud, but I can't find a part number anywhere.

Or maybe someone knows of an equivalent part??

After lots of searching for hydraulic fittings replacements, I found it...at Rosenthal...and On mazdaspeed:

Oil filter "Joint", stud, pipe, fitting, what-ever-you-want-to-call-it.
90-93 - B630-10-319
94+- E5B6-10-319C

Other numbers associated:
BP4W-10-319
